
Gerard Pique and Shakira Respond to Sex Tape Blackmail Allegations
A spokesperson for Barcelona defender Gerard Pique has denied allegations that he and his girlfriend Shakira are being blackmailed over a sex tape, according to Stuart Fraser of the MailOnline.
As reported by Fraser, Spanish newspaperย Diario Vasco had made claims that the Spain international and his pop star partner were being held to ransom for a โbig sum of moneyโ by a previous employee over a clip which was suggested to have contained โerotic content.โ
Rob Burnett of the Daily Mirror also wrote that the reports have been denied by a โsource close to the starโ: โThis is a very random report and completely untrue.โ

Pique and Shakira met in 2010 when the former appeared on the latterโs official World Cup song video. They now have two sons together, two-year-old Milan and 11-month-old Sasha.
The report surfaced just weeks after a scandal came to light involving France international midfielder Mathieu Valbuena, in which the Lyon man was said to be the target of a blackmail plot involving a sex tape.
Real Madrid forward Karim Benzema was arrested by French police as part of the investigation in Valbuenaโs case, per AFP (h/t the Daily Telegraph). As noted by Fraser, the strikerโs lawyers claim he had โno partโ to play in any attempt to swindle his international team-mate out of money. If found guilty, he could face a prison sentence of up to five years.
Pique and Benzema could go up against each other this weekend, as Real Madrid welcome Barcelona to the Santiago Bernabeu for a highly anticipated Clasico showdown.
